THE BUSINESS UNIT
Rexnord Aerospace is a growing and profitable supplier of engineered high performance bearings and mechanical seals to the commercial air transport, regional aircraft, business aircraft, helicopter and military aircraft markets for use in engine systems, flight control systems, airframe structures and landing gear systems. Our aerospace bearing and seal products consist of rolling element airframe bearings and bearing tooling sold under the Shafer and Tri-Roller brand names, Teflon lined polymeric bearings sold under the Tuflite brand name, slotted entry, split ball and split race bearings sold under the PSI brand name, self-lubricating machinable lined bearings and coatings sold under the Rexlon brand name and mechanical seals sold under the Cartriseal brand name. Our global customer base includes all major engine and airframe OEM's, as well as major Tier 1, 2 and 3 suppliers to the engine and airframe OEM's and through our FAA approved repair station we support major MRO and aircraft operators with repair and overhaul capabilities.
